Output ecc1bd3520393a95e4b795e62357c4ad11dfa02a5dc333f88d3f8a34b0e6f01c:1

value
1496660
script pubkey
OP_0 OP_PUSHBYTES_20 c8ba936ce38a34259009992326fc1348ea08689d
address
bc1qezafxm8r3g6ztyqfny3jdlqnfr4qs6yake3kfd
transaction
ecc1bd3520393a95e4b795e62357c4ad11dfa02a5dc333f88d3f8a34b0e6f01c